Schedule and price should determine. I avoid WN connections, which is fairly easy for me as my principal airport is BNA. The trouble with WN connections is that if your connecting time has been shortened due to late aircraft arrival, your seating options are no longer optimal- if they've boarded Groups A and B already when you get to the connecting gate.

I'm not a huge fan of Delta for many reasons, from too-crowded SkyClubs, to rude or under-informed phone agents (after a four hour wait for a call back), to mishandled refunds. I could go on and on. I won't. Delta- meh.

Unless you have top tier elite status with an airline, I say go by price and schedule.
